ETHICS IN PUBLISHING
All IFIASA Journals & Proceedings are open access resources. The manuscripts submitted are evaluated for scientific content, on conditions of equality for all authors. All the papers received are analyzed and assessed by the Editorial Board and subsequently undergo a peer-review process. The editorial committee encourages the publication of scientific articles under the condition of respecting the ethical values regarding scientific research.
The editorial committee ensures all authors that the confidentiality and impartiality regarding the process of reviewing their works are respected. Criteria for accepting a paper are: relevance of the study for the field in which it fits; observance of the drafting criteria and scientific accuracy. The articles are published only after double-blind peer review evaluation and upon receiving the “ready for publication” notice. Papers which do not meet the publication criteria will be sent back with comments and suggestions for improvement.
Publishers will guarantee reviewers anonymity.
Publishers will provide guidance to reviewers regarding their expectations in the evaluation process.
Duties of peer reviewers Contribution to editorial decisions
Peer review assists the Editor-in-Chief in making editorial decisions and, through editorial communication with the author, may also assist the author in improving the manuscript.
The referees who decline their expertise in the field of research of the paper attributed to them for review or who know that they cannot provide feedback in a timely manner are kindly asked to notify the Editor-in-Chief so that alternative reviewers can be contacted.
Publication and authorship
Submitting a paper for publication in any of the IFIASA Journals and Proceedings entails that the paper has never been published, or is it under evaluation by another publisher.
Authors are invited to submit original and previously unpublished papers.
The IFIASA Journals & Proceedings are based on systematic review and abide by the same publication policy.
The practice of peer-review is intended to ensure that only qualitative papers published. Peer-reviewing is an objective process at the heart of good scholarly publishing and is carried out by all reputable scientific Journals. Our referees therefore play a vital role in maintaining the high standards of IFIASA.
All submitted manuscripts to the IFASA Journals & Proceedings are subject to a strict peer-review process.
IFIASA journals & Proceedings operates a double-blind peer review process.
To facilitate this process, authors are requested to ensure that all references made to their own previously published work are impersonal.
Reviewers are selected by the editor-in-chief, after consultations with the members of the editorial board.
Authors will be notified that the manuscript has been received. Please note that the peer-review process might take, in some cases, 1 up to 2 months. Authors will be notified of acceptance for publication as soon as the reviewers’ answers are received.
Accepted articles are usually published in the forthcoming issue of the journal.
If the reviewers’ opinions are significantly divergent, a third reviewer will be assigned to the manuscript. Authors might be required to revise the manuscript according to the recommendations of the reviewers.
Revised manuscripts should be accompanied by a point-by-point reply to the recommendations of reviewers, specifying the changes made in the revised version or the reasons why authors decided to decline reviewers’ recommendation(s).
The factors taken into account in reviewing a paper are: relevance, soundness, significance, originality, readability and language.
The possible decisions include acceptance, acceptance with revisions, or rejection.
If authors revise and resubmit a paper, there is no guarantee that the revised submission will be accepted. The revised paper will undergo a second review, carried out either by the anonymous reviewer or by the Editorial Board. The second decision is definitive.
Rejected manuscripts will not be re-reviewed.
Acceptance is constrained by such legal requirements as shall then be in force regarding libel, copyright infringement and plagiarism.
